HPE OneView 4.10 Library

Add-HPOVStorageSystem

Import a supported Storage System

SYNTAX

Add-HPOVStorageSystem [-Hostname] <String>[ [-Credential] <PSCredential PSCredential>][ [-Username] <String>][ [-Password] <Object>][ [-Family] <String>][ [-Domain] <String>][ [-Ports] <Object>][ [-PortGroups] <Hashtable>][ [-ShowSystemDetails] <SwitchParameter>][ [-ApplianceConnection] <Array>] [<CommonParameters>]
Add-HPOVStorageSystem [-Hostname] <String> [-VIPS] <Hashtable>[ [-Credential] <PSCredential PSCredential>][ [-Username] <String>][ [-Password] <Object>][ [-Family] <String>][ [-ShowSystemDetails] <SwitchParameter>][ [-ApplianceConnection] <Array>] [<CommonParameters>]

Detailed Description

This cmdlet will assist with importing a supported Storage System. In order for the Storage Ports to be mapped to Expected Networks, either a Supported SAN Manager will need to be configured, or 3PAR Direct Attach networks will have to exist.

When adding supported HP 3PAR storage systems, please make sure "startwsapi" has been executed from the HP 3PAR CLI, which enables the HP 3PAR REST API that is required by HPE OneView.

Examples

 -------------------------- EXAMPLE 1 --------------------------

$task = Add-HPOVStorageSystem -hostname "3par-array.consoto.com" -username 3paradm -password 3pardata -Async Wait-HPOVTaskComplete $task

Add the Storage System using default settings, and let the appliance detect the connected Storage System Ports. (A supported SAN Manager must first be added, and Managed SANs mapped to the specific FC Network resources.)

 -------------------------- EXAMPLE 2 --------------------------

$StorageSystemPorts = @{"1:1:1" = "Fabric A"; "2:1:1" = "Fabric A"; "1:1:2" = "Fabric B"; "2:1:2" = "Fabric B"} $StoragePortGroups = @{"1:1:1"= "PG1"; "2:1:1" = "PG1"; "1:1:2" = "PG2"; "2:1:2" = "PG2"} Add-HPOVStorageSystem -hostname "3par-array.consoto.com" -username 3paradm -password 3pardata -Domain VirtaulDomain1 -Ports $StorageSystemPorts -PortGroups $StoragePortGroups | Wait-HPOVTaskComplete

Add the Storage System using default settings, and specify the Storage System Ports that will be assigned to the Expected Networks.

 -------------------------- EXAMPLE 3 --------------------------

$IscsiNetwork = Get-HPOVNetwork -Name "IscsiNetwork" -ErrorAction Stop $StoreVirtualAddress = "storevirtual1.domain.com" $StorageSystemPSCredential = Get-Credential -Username administrator Add-HPOVStorageSystem -Family StoreVirtual -Hostname $StoreVirtualAddress -Credential $StorageSystemPSCredential -VIPS @{ "192.168.191.22" = $IscsiNetwork }

Add a StoreVirtual storage system with PSCredential object.
